The True Meaning of Christmas

Seeking is very important. The wise men followed a star, seeking the Christ Child. The shepherds sought the baby Jesus after having been given a hint by the angels (“you will find Him wrapped in swaddling clothes and laying in a manger”). Jesus’ mother sought for Jesus, and found Him in the temple (at which point He said, “don’t you know I must be about my Father’s business?”) The centurion whose daughter was sick came to seek Jesus, and when he found Him, the daughter was healed. Jesus told parables involving seeking: where, for example, the master came back and sought the servant, where the prodigal son sought his father, where the bridesmaids sought the bride, or where the shepherd sought the lost sheep. When Jesus was killed, Mary and Martha came to seek Him, but He was risen. In the Sermon on the Mount, Jesus said: “seek and ye shall find.” Time and again, the process of seeking is important.
